Scientific Calculator

Advanced Scientific Calculator - Professional Grade Math Tool Online
0
Memory Value: 0

What is an Advanced Scientific Calculator?

An advanced scientific calculator is a professional-grade mathematical tool that goes far beyond basic arithmetic and standard scientific functions. It includes calculation history tracking, memory functions, hyperbolic trigonometry, exponential operations, degree/radian conversion, and precision control—all essential for engineers, scientists, mathematicians, and professionals requiring sophisticated calculations.

Advanced Features Explained

Calculation History

Every calculation is automatically saved in the history panel. Click any previous calculation to restore it instantly. This feature is invaluable for:

  • Verifying previous calculations
  • Building upon past results
  • Avoiding repetitive typing
  • Tracking calculation sequences
  • Learning from calculation patterns

Memory Functions

The calculator includes complete memory management:

  • MC (Memory Clear): Erase stored value
  • MR (Memory Recall): Retrieve stored value
  • M+ (Memory Add): Add current result to memory
  • M− (Memory Subtract): Subtract from memory
  • MS (Memory Save): Save current value
  • M× (Memory Multiply): Multiply memory value

Hyperbolic Functions

Hyperbolic functions (sinh, cosh, tanh) are crucial for:

  • Electrical engineering calculations
  • Physics wave equations
  • Exponential growth modeling
  • Advanced calculus problems

Angle Conversion

Instantly convert between degrees and radians with dedicated buttons. This prevents calculation errors and saves time when switching between different measurement systems.

Precision Control

Choose your desired decimal precision (4, 6, 8, or 10 decimals) based on your requirements. This is essential for:

  • Scientific research requiring specific precision
  • Engineering tolerances
  • Financial calculations
  • Reducing display clutter

Key Functions Comparison

Function Category Basic Version Advanced Version
History Tracking ❌ No ✅ Full History
Memory Functions ❌ No ✅ 6 Memory Operations
Trigonometry ✅ sin, cos, tan ✅ + inverse + hyperbolic
Precision Control ❌ Fixed ✅ 4-10 Decimals
Angle Conversion ❌ Manual ✅ One-Click
Expression Display ❌ No ✅ Full Expression
Exponential Functions ✅ Basic ✅ e^x, x^y, roots
Keyboard Support ✅ Yes ✅ Enhanced

Real-World Use Cases

Engineering Calculations

Calculate complex circuits using hyperbolic functions and exponential operations. The memory functions allow you to save intermediate results and build upon them progressively.

Scientific Research

With adjustable precision and calculation history, track all your experimental calculations and verify results instantly. The history panel helps you document your calculation process.

Financial Analysis

Memory functions are perfect for accumulating values in financial calculations. Store constants like inflation rates or interest rates in memory for repeated use.

Academic Studies

The history feature helps students learn by tracking calculation sequences and understanding how results build upon each other.

Professional Tips

  • Use Memory for Constants: Save frequently-used values (π, conversion factors) in memory
  • Check Angle Mode: Always verify degree/radian setting before trigonometric calculations
  • Review History: Use the history panel to verify calculation sequences
  • Set Appropriate Precision: Match decimal places to your data's precision
  • Copy Accurate Results: Use the copy button to avoid transcription errors
  • Leverage Memory Operations: Use M+ and M− for accumulating values

FAQs

What are hyperbolic functions and when do I use them?
Hyperbolic functions (sinh, cosh, tanh) are mathematical functions analogous to trigonometric functions but based on hyperbolas instead of circles. They're essential in physics (catenary curves, wave equations), electrical engineering, and advanced calculus. They describe exponential growth patterns that are common in nature.
How does the memory function work?
The memory function stores a single value that persists across calculations. You can add to it (M+), subtract from it (M−), multiply it (M×), save new values (MS), and retrieve it (MR). This is perfect for accumulating totals or storing constants for repeated calculations.
Why would I need different precision levels?
Different applications require different precision levels. Financial calculations might need 2 decimals, scientific research might need 8-10 decimals, while engineering often uses 4-6 decimals. Using appropriate precision prevents false accuracy claims and improves readability.
How do I convert between degrees and radians?
Enter your value, switch to the Advanced tab, and click either →rad (to convert degrees to radians) or →deg (to convert radians to degrees). The conversion happens instantly. Alternatively, select your preferred angle mode at the top before entering trigonometric values.
Can I save my calculation history?
The calculator displays your calculation history in the right panel during your session. Click any calculation to use it again. The history remains available until you close the page or clear it using the clear button. For permanent saving, use the copy button to save important results.
How accurate are calculations with the exponential function?
The exponential functions (e^x, x^y) use JavaScript's Math library, which implements IEEE 754 double precision, providing 15-17 significant digits of accuracy. This is suitable for virtually all professional and scientific applications.
What is the difference between ln and log?
log is the logarithm base 10 (common logarithm), while ln is the natural logarithm (base e). Natural logarithm is more commonly used in science and calculus. The choice depends on your field: engineers often use log₁₀, scientists typically use ln (natural log).

More Professional Tools